What I do like about these guitars is the auto-tuning system. But what about changing tunings? From standard to drop D or half step down on all strings... I always ask the same question: how good is that for the guitar? I've been told that to change guitar tunings and do it right best thing is to set-up the whole guitar (intonation, neck relief, etc.). This system only turns the pegs. In terms of electronics, they are trying to do what I already got in my Brian Moore guitar - eg. hooking up piezo electronics and humbuckers and use the piezo's to enable different tunings amongst other things. The bad news here is that all this stuff goes on-board instead of using external interfaces, hence - that would have allowed You to choose interface.... What they should have done is to take the classic LP and just mounted a piezo under the bridge and provided a 13-pin output. That would have made a killer guitar... This one is a joke....
